149 Licences and permits—general provisions
S. 149(1) substituted by No. 5/1997
s. 40(1).
(1) While a licence is suspended under this Act, the person who holds the licence is to be treated as if he or she did not hold the licence.
S. 149(2) repealed by No. 5/1997
s. 40(1), new s. 149(2) inserted by No. 108/2003 s. 43.
(2) Nothing in subsection (1) is intended to interfere with the right of the person to hold the licence—subsection (1) is merely intended to ensure that the person cannot exercise the rights of a licence holder while the licence is suspended.
S. 149(3) amended by No. 5/1997
s. 40(2).
(3) The holder of a licence or permit or the personal representative of a deceased holder of a licence or permit or a registered financial interest in a licence may surrender the licence or permit in accordance with the regulations.
